Minnesota National Guard, Croatia Collaborate via State Partnership Program
June 29, 2022
Seven crew chiefs with the Minnesota National Guard’s Bravo Company, 834th Aviation Support Battalion, were sent to Croatia to advise and assist the Croatian Armed Forces as they integrated UH-60M Black Hawks into their Air Force. Minnesota and Croatia have been partners under the Department of Defense National Guard Bureau State Partnership Program since 1996.

Northern Agility 22-1 Begins in Michigan’s Upper Peninsula
June 28, 2022
A U.S. Air Force KC-135 Stratotanker from the 191st Air Refueling Group, Selfridge Air National Guard Base, Michigan,  arrives at Sawyer International Airport, Marquette, Michigan, to support Agile Combat Employment training as multicapable Airmen during the Northern Agility 22-1 exercise, June 27, 2022. Northern Agility 22-1 tests the rapid insertion of an Air Expeditionary Wing into a bare-base environment to establish logistics and communications and enhance the ability to operate in austere environments.
